580. Deputy Aengus Ó Snodaigh asked the Minister for Culture, Heritage and the Gaeltacht if her attention has been drawn to plans to create a museum of policing in the former Garda station in Kevin Street in view of its historical role in policing history (details supplied); if she has discussed the matter with the Minister for Justice and Equality or the Minister for Public Expenditure and Reform;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[29278/18]
